"Success is not final, failure is not fatal: it is the courage to continue that counts." - Winston Churchill
The quote by Winston Churchill emphasizes the importance of perseverance in achieving success. It highlights that success is not an endpoint but a continuous process, and failures are inevitable parts of this journey. However, what truly matters is our ability to learn from these setbacks and keep moving forward with courage.
"The greatest glory in living lies not in never falling, but in rising every time we fall." - Nelson Mandela
This quote by Nelson Mandela conveys a powerful message about resilience and determination. It reminds us that life's challenges will inevitably lead to falls or setbacks, but it's how we respond to them that defines our character. By choosing to rise again after each fall, we demonstrate strength and the capacity for personal growth.
"You don't have to be great to start, but you have to start to be great." - Zig Ziglar
Ziglar's statement encourages individuals who may feel hesitant or unsure about their abilities due to fear of failure or lack of experience. His words remind us that greatness does not come from being perfect; rather it comes from taking action towards our goals no matter how small they may seem at first.
"Do something today that your future self will thank you for." - Unknown
This inspirational quote serves as a reminder for people who often put off important tasks until later because they might feel overwhelmed or uncertain about their priorities. It urges readers to take control over their lives now by making decisions based on long-term benefits rather than short-term gains.
"Keep your eyes on the stars, and your feet on the ground." - Theodore Roosevelt
Theodore Roosevelt's wise words offer guidance for those seeking balance between ambition and reality while pursuing their dreams or goals in life. He suggests maintaining focus on one’s aspirations while staying grounded with practicality – ensuring progress without losing sight of what can realistically be achieved along the way.
